ABSTRACT

This chapter provides an introduction to public health ideas about compassionate cities. Conceptual and policy antecedents are critically described linking these to earlier developments in health promotion and healthy cities theories. The international charter commonly employed to guide compassionate cities is reproduced and its role in creating or guiding social actions is explained. Finally, two examples of compassionate cities are described—one from England and the other from Spain. The chapter ends with a final reflection on the future of these public health experiments.
